Transformers and its cop history is so... I don't even have the words, the strangest thing to me is that initially Prowl is the Autobot military strategist. He's not a law enforcer or even has a role of security in the Autobots. His alt mode is a police car
With how many continuities Transformers and new designs for characters have had (most notable is Michael Bay live movies popularising Bumblebee as a sports car and making it more prevalent in Transformers media onwards, compared to his original Volkswagen Beetle alt mode), it surprises me that Prowl has remained with a police car alt mode or has been given roles more reminiscent— if not blatantly stated, to be a law enforcer
Why has this persisted? Especially when in recent years law enforcement has notably been under criticism (to put things lightly). There is no actual reason for why Prowl has to be a police officer or have an alt mode of a police vehicle. It's not really an integral aspect of the character's personality at all and yet that's how everyone characterises Prowl as, "The Cop." Which is through no fault of their own really because he's been a cop/cop vehicle in every appearance he's had from my knowledge. I have always been slightly uncomfortable with Prowl's (unnecessary, imo) connection to law enforcement, enjoying the character and his actual personality becomes difficult because he is so heavily associated with law enforcement/being a police officer
Well, I think it's pretty clear why this has persisted. And I was actually thinking about something similar recently, which is that the version of Barricade who has a police car alt-mode is a really, really strange character because he wasn't created or portrayed as an ACAB statement, but instead he was meant to subvert the idea that cops are safe people who should be respected. Like, we as an audience are expected to share a base assumption that cops are good guys, and it's frankly embarrassing and gross that this approach to the character has been featured as late as IDW2. Analysis of how Prowl has been utilized under the cut:
Of course, Prowl's original alt-mode was a Nissan Fairlady Z painted to be a specialized police pursuit vehicle as used in Japan, so basically a sports coupe repurposed into a cop car for police chases. And he had this design because he was pretty much just a reissue of the Diaclone police car toy. As you mentioned, the character himself wasn't a cop originally—instead, I would say his vehicle mode more metaphorically represented the characterization he had, in which he will stop at nothing to "pursue" his goals and will radio his leader constantly when he doesn't know what to do.
Tumblr media
I also do remember one early comic in which Prowl uses his alt-mode to tell humans to evacuate a dangerous area, and I think there's something to be said for a cop car being a logical choice for a disguise because it can be utilized in ways like that.
Sometimes people say that the Prowl from TFA (who I do really like!) manages to escape problematic implications such as copaganda, but while I do really appreciate that reinvention of the character, he really doesn't. I mean, he still turns into a police vehicle in that series, and the show pushed for him to become friends with a cop who has bigoted beliefs.
What's at the heart of the complete disaster area Prowl became are writers and artists who have base assumptions that inform their work. Writers who are privileged and believe copaganda are just going to do things like this. That's why Prowl became more and more of a cop over time. When those writers and that artist working on IDW2 had a comic sign off on police brutality and showed the proto-Decepticons using an altered version of a real-world anti-racist slogan, that's why, and it's why in the creators' apologies they reveal they never even thought about what they were implying—probably because these issues don't really impact their lives. This is how copaganda even ends up in things like Rescue Bots.
Fandom is guilty here as well. Before Prowl as an angry controlling cop existed in canon media, fans were writing that in their fanfictions, and this portrayal became more and more popular and started to leak into canon over time. And then when it started to appear in canon media, people ate it up and didn't want this characterization to be reverted, and it still persists now. So no, there's no reason Prowl had to be this way, but he has been, it's a pattern, and it has to be addressed in official media at some point. And to be honest, I don't know how it could be... like reverting him to an earlier characterization and having him turn into something else would be nice, but then it's kind of sweeping the history under the rug. Deleting him from existence or having him be a villain wouldn't work because he's literally the Autobots' logo. Maybe it could be tackled by both reverting him to an earlier characterization and having him go through a character arc in which he learns to grow beyond black-and-white thinking or something? He's definitely always had major flaws even before this whole mess, so it could work.
And before somebody comes at me with something like, "Okay but IDW Prowl isn't copaganda and is fine because the story is critical of his actions," I'll say this: okay, but if Nick Roche was going to create a character to explore that, why did he choose to make him a gay, mentally ill, disabled guy? Those are the traits of people who cops murder and oppress. It's like JRo with Chromedome—why would he choose to have one of the first prominent gay characters in his story not only be struggling with addiction, but be struggling with an addiction to violating people and causing them irreparable harm? It's just a different form of problematic.

Nissan Z Proto unveiled for the first time
Nissan Z Proto unveiled for the first time
The new Z is coming.
Nissan today unveiled the Z Proto, signaling the company’s intent to launch a new generation of the legendary Z sports car. Shown at a virtual event beamed around the world from the Nissan Pavilion in Yokohama, the prototype car features a new design inside and out, as well as a V-6 twin turbocharged engine with a manual transmission.

What a difference 52 years makes juxtaposition of Datsun 240Z, 1971 and Nissan Z, 2023. The series production version of the new generation Z-car has been revealed with a 400hp 3.0 litre twin turbo V6. For the US market it will be available in Sport, Performance and Proto Spec versions (Performance model shown).

First Look: The Nissan Z
Nissan revealed the all-new 2023 Z sports car in a global broadcast from Brooklyn’s Duggal Greenhouse, about five miles from where the original 1970 Datsun 240Z made its world debut in October 1969.
"When we introduced the Z in 1969, the Z was a revolution. Since then, for more than 50 years, Nissan has brought style, speed, reliability and so much more to millions of enthusiasts around the world,” said Ashwani Gupta, representative executive officer and chief operating officer, Nissan Motor Co., Ltd.
While the six previous generations of Nissan’s iconic sports car all offered numeric designations, the long-awaited redesign will be known in the United States simply by just one letter – Z.
The 2023 Z offers a sleek, attractive exterior with a silhouette that shows respect for the original model – with a long hood and low rear stance. Inside, the driver-centric cockpit includes a 12.3-inch customizable racing-inspired meter display, available leather-appointed sports seats and 8-speaker Bose® audio system.
All 2023 Nissan Z models are equipped with a 400-horsepower 3.0-liter V6 twin-turbo engine and choice of 6-speed manual transmission with motorsports-inspired EXEDY high-performance clutch, or a new 9-speed automatic transmission with aluminum paddle shifters.
"The Z has always been an accessible sports car – always placed at the intersection of aspiration and attainability – of dreams and reality. This latest iteration is now ready to thrill Z enthusiasts, and create a whole new generation of Z fans as well, when it comes to market here in the U.S. early next year,” said Gupta.
The 2023 Z is offered in Sport and Performance grade levels and a special "Proto Spec” edition, which is limited to 240 units.

The Return of Z
Tumblr media
June 2009 marked the debut of the sixth generation Nissan Z-car: The 370Z. Since then, it has been updated a number of times, including the introduction of the Nismo trim. The 370Z Nismo features various aerodynamic, interior, power, handling and ECU tuning upgrades. But, despite the time and effort put into the 370Z over the years, it is almost entirely the same car that debuted back in 2009 in terms of design and technology. With it still being sold new in 2020, it no longer feels like the fresh modern sports car it once was due to its dated looking interior and minimally updated exterior.
11 years of production for a single model is a long time. Z fans have been longing for a new model for quite some time now…
Unveiled on September 15, 2020, the new Nissan Z Proto is a preview of the upcoming seventh generation Z-car to replace the aging 370. Finally!
Like Z cars of the past, it will feature a V6 engine, RWD drivetrain, two doors, two seats and a standard 6 speed manual transmission.
Exterior
The most interesting aspect of the Z Proto, rumored to be called 400Z once it reaches production, is the design. Let’s begin with the exterior. The exterior design is heavily inspired by classic Z cars of the past. This mainly includes the original Datsun 240Z from the early to late 70s and the fourth generation 300ZX of the 90s. 
Front
The front fascia is all 240Z inspired. The headlight shape is designed to resemble the 240Z’s entire headlamp assembly, not just the circular headlights themselves, which includes the surrounding tear-drop shaped housing. According to Alfonso Albaisa, Senior vice president of Global Design for Nissan, the two half-circle LED daytime running light arcs are designed to represent the natural reflections of a 240Z headlamp assembly with glass covers specifically. 
The grille is almost identical to that of the classic, with a blunt rectangular shape that visually connects to the headlights through a swooping bumper line that runs underneath the lights. 
Another notable detail is the triangular bulge on the hood, just like on the original.

Personally, I love the front fascia design as is because of its immediate resemblance to the original Z of the 70s in an elegant modern-retro rendition. But it is currently the center of debate and mixed opinion, with the grille being the most talked about aspect. One potential design concern I can see with the current grille shape is that it may be a bit too rectangular considering the flowing lines of the headlights and overall body shape. However, I believe that it is a necessary design element because of its key role in the Proto’s beautifully crafted resemblance to the original 240Z that takes no more than a second to recognize.
Side
Moving to the side-profile, and we see an overall resemblance to the classic sports coupe shape of the 240Z, with a sloped rear, elongated hood, small triangular rear-quarter window, and, my favorite, a rear-quarter panel mounted Z badge. Awesome!

Rear
Now let’s get to the rear. Here we have a resemblance to a different classic Z-car. The 90’s 300ZX. This can be seen in the horizontal double rectangle brake lights, with a black painted area in between. This is exactly the design of the taillights of the 300ZX, but with modern LED technology. We can also see some 300ZX in the bumper design, with a horizontal line underlining the taillight assembly.

A cool detail to note about the rear is the diagonal trunk-mounted Fairlady Z badge, made to the style of the original “Datsun 240Z” badge. “Fairlady” is the name used for Z cars sold in Japan. For example, the 370Z is called Fairlady Z Z34 in Japan (Z34 being the code for the sixth generation Z).

Interior
Transitioning to the interior, and we have a modern, sleek and sporty design. The center gauge cluster is all digital. The main center dashboard is clean with minimal buttons. The steering wheel looks slim and comfortable for the hands. The analog gauges on top of the dashboard are a throwback to the 240Z. The contrast yellow stitching across the dashboard, armrests and seats is a neat color-coded touch to the yellow exterior. And finally, the 6 speed manual transmission and physical e-brake are welcoming features in a world where manual transmissions are becoming rare even among sports cars, and physical e-brakes have almost entirely been replaced with buttons.

While the interior does not share the exterior’s affection for classic Z cars (aside from the analog pod gauges), its design looks well-suited for a modern sports car of the 2020’s.
An interesting detail about the interior is the door handles and side vents. I noticed almost immediately that they are identical to the ones in the 370Z, which itself had the same door handles and side vents as the preceding 350Z of the early 2000’s. This means that there could be more parts in the Z Proto that have been taken directly from the 370Z, potentially to reduce cost of production once it goes on sale. Personally I don’t mind this, considering the otherwise brand new design inside and out.
Conclusion
Overall, the design of the Z Proto has left a strong positive impression. It looks sleek, streamlined and beautifully modern-retro. Current information suggests a 2021 release, which would likely make the 400Z a 2022 model year car, with an estimated base price of $45,000. It will be powered by a 300 hp, 3.0 liter twin turbo V6 from the current Infiniti Q60.
Considering the estimated release date, the Z Proto is likely almost entirely production-ready in terms of design and technology. So despite being a prototype, what we see here today, is likely what we will see next year. Some minor changes are always a possibility though.
Enthusiasts have waited long enough for a new Z-car, and we are nearly there. A new era of Z is coming.
